Supporting circular economies

Supporting a circular economy has become an important concern for many. It involves breaking free from conventional 'take, make, waste' production cycles and embracing a sustainable approach where everything has value, and nothing is wasted. This way of thinking not only preserves our environment but also opens up new opportunities for consumers and businesses alike.

Embrace a culture of renting and sharing

Renting and sharing resources instead of buying new ones is an influential factor in promoting a circular economy. When you participate in this system, you help extend the lifetime of products, reducing the need for new products to be made and reducing waste.

Perhaps you only need a baking mixer's occasional use, or you are looking to clean up your house in spring; renting equipment becomes a more ideal option. You'll not only minimize your expenses but also evade the problem of storage. Plus, by doing this, you allow others the convenience of accessing an item they might need without having to own it.

Choose refurbished or second-hand items

Choosing refurbished or second-hand items, you can drastically decrease demand for new products, decreasing the resource extraction and manufacturing processes that often harm our environment.

For example, consider renting refurbished cooking or cleaning appliances. These items are as efficient as the new ones but much more affordable, and by considering this option, you're reusing an item instead of causing more waste. Besides, it allows you to experiment with different equipment, deciding what you like before buying.

Participate in community recycling programs

Community recycling programs are another effective avenue for bolstering a circular economy. These programs aim at collecting used items and recycling them into new products, or refurbishing them for other uses, thereby reducing waste.

Community recycling programs allow for the reuse and proper disposal of items that once seen as waste. Thus, we can cut down on what goes to landfills or pollutes our environment. This contribution, while seemingly small, is an engaging way to make a positive environmental impact in your locale.
